Perfectly steamed eggs

One egg (about 50-60 grams) with 100 grams of water.
According to this ratio, decide for yourself how many eggs you want. How much water. -
Add water and salt to the main pot.
50 degrees / 4 minutes / speed 1 -
Set 30 sec/speed 4 Add the eggs
from the lid of the measuring cup.
Beat the eggs beforehand or add them whole. -
In this way, the eggs will be gray and even. No filtering.
-
Pour the egg wash onto a plate.
Let sit for 10 minutes to make the bubbles disappear.
If there are bubbles before steaming, use a spoon to remove the large bubbles. -
Put 600 grams of water in the main pot, 20 minutes/varoma/speed tablespoon. -
When you see steam, put the steamer on the rack. The time is changed to 15 minutes/varoma/scoop.
-
Remove the steamed eggs. Perfectly smooth surface.
-
Light soy sauce, sesame oil, and a little black pepper stir in a small bowl
-
Drizzle the sauce over the stew.
